Youth Olympic steeplechase champion Peter Mutuku dies

The IAAF is deeply saddened to hear that Kenyan steeplechaser Peter Mutuku died in a car accident on 10 July, aged 20.

Three other athletes – 2011 world youth 3000m silver medallist Patrick Mutunga, 2010 world junior 800m champion David Mutua and Joshua Maingi – were in the car at the time, but managed to survive.

Born in January 1994, Mutuka came to prominence in 2010 when he struck gold in the 2000m steeplechase at the Youth Olympic Games in Singapore. He set his 3000m steeplechase PB of 8:40.2 two years later at the age of 19.
